中文字幕av专区_日韩电影在线播放_精品国产精品久久一区免费式_av在线免费观看网站

溫馨提示×

delphi指針的用法是什么

小億
99
2023-12-01 18:10:34
欄目: 編程語言

Delphi中的指針用于在程序中處理內存地址和動態分配的內存。指針可以用于訪問和操作內存中的數據。

在Delphi中,可以使用^操作符聲明指針變量,例如:

var
  ptr: ^Integer; //聲明一個指向整數的指針變量

使用New關鍵字可以動態分配內存,并將分配的內存地址賦給指針變量,例如:

ptr := New(Integer); //動態分配一個整數大小的內存,并將地址賦給指針變量

可以使用^操作符來訪問指針所指向的內存中的數據,例如:

ptr^ := 10; //將值10存儲到指針所指向的內存中

使用Dispose關鍵字可以釋放通過New動態分配的內存,例如:

Dispose(ptr); //釋放ptr指向的內存

指針還可以用于傳遞參數給函數或過程,以便在函數或過程中修改參數的值。

需要注意的是,指針操作需要謹慎使用,因為錯誤的指針操作可能會導致程序崩潰或產生不可預料的結果。在使用指針時,務必確保指針指向有效的內存地址,并在不再需要時及時釋放內存。

0
沧州市| 新源县| 淮北市| 信阳市| 本溪| 双鸭山市| 霍城县| 随州市| 双江| 新蔡县| 滁州市| 磐石市| 新龙县| 乌拉特中旗| 五莲县| 麟游县| 阜城县| 苏州市| 雷山县| 基隆市| 阿拉善盟| 乡宁县| 沂源县| 晴隆县| 沧源| 连山| 历史| 深水埗区| 吉林省| 全椒县| 河间市| 巴里| 灌南县| 墨竹工卡县| 平顺县| 景宁| 桂东县| 洛阳市| 大同县| 万山特区| 林州市|